Skimmer Question

Need to add a skimmer to my new set up (120 gallon with a eShopps R-200 sump). My sump water depth in the skimmer area is 9" to 10". My LFS recommended the eShopps S200 skimmer which has a recommended water depth of 7" to 9" inches.

https://www.bulkreefsupply.com/s-200...er-eshopps.htm

I had a bubble magus curve 7 on my last tank and really liked it. Looking at the bubble magus curve 7 elite skimmer

https://www.aquacave.com/bubble-magu...e-psk-600.html

This one has a recommended water depth of 9.5 inches to 11 inches which would really work well in my sump.

Since there is a pretty good price difference, wondering which on of these would be a better or is there another skimmer that I should be looking at? Would prefer an internal pump to save some space for other equipment in the sump.
